|

楼主 |
发表于 2009-5-6 15:36:10
|
显示全部楼层
看了一下 mplayer 的输出:- Opening audio decoder: [ffmpeg] FFmpeg/libavcodec audio decoders
- Cannot find codec 'amr_nb' in libavcodec...
- ADecoder init failed :(
- ADecoder init failed :(
- Cannot find codec for audio format 0x726D6173.
- Read DOCS/HTML/en/codecs.html!
- Audio: no sound
复制代码 看来需要 amr ...
搜了一下,amr 应该由 ffmpeg 提供, 这是我的 ffmpeg 信息:- $ ffmpeg --help
- FFmpeg version SVN-rUNKNOWN, Copyright (c) 2000-2007 Fabrice Bellard, et al.
- configuration: --prefix=/usr --libdir=/usr/lib64 --mandir=/usr/share/man --incdir=/usr/include/ffmpeg --extra-cflags=-fPIC --enable-libmp3lame --enable-libogg --enable-libvorbis --enable-libogg --enable-libtheora --enable-libfaad --enable-libfaac --enable-libgsm --enable-xvid --enable-x264 --enable-liba52 --enable-liba52bin --enable-pp --enable-shared --enable-pthreads --enable-gpl --disable-strip
- libavutil version: 49.4.0
- libavcodec version: 51.40.4
- libavformat version: 51.12.1
- built on Jun 4 2007 10:46:34, gcc: 4.1.1 20070105 (Red Hat 4.1.1-52)
- ffmpeg: missing argument for option '--help'
复制代码 难道 ffmpeg 没有提供 amr? |
|